Princeton's WordNet

  1. Stopes, Marie Stopes, Marie Charlotte Carmichael Stopesnoun

    birth-control campaigner who in 1921 opened the first birth control clinic in London (1880-1958)

ChatGPT

  1. stopes

    Stopes is a mining term that refers to an underground excavation made by removing ore from surrounding rock. This process can occur in various directions and sizes, creating an open space left after the extraction of valuable minerals. They are critical in underground mining as they allow miners to access and remove mineral deposits.
